Product Description

A Pride Mobility Authorized Provider - TOP MOBILITY
The original drink cup holder that works with the Go-Go Travel Scooter line
Model 2288 - Molded seat - C style Apparatus
This folding design flips up when not in use
We have this cup holder available so you can customize your scooter to meet your needs and make it more unique and compatible.

Nevertheless, I am most disappointed in the fact that it is really designed for cans only
3/5

the installation is a bit of a hassle since you have to remove the top of the arm rest (and ensure you order the correct model as there are three distinct variations depending on which scooter you have). Nevertheless, I am most disappointed in the fact that it is really designed for cans only. A can or larger won't fit because the overhang of the armrest hits it.
